Standard Access Panel

Standard access panels are the most common type used in construction and maintenance. Made from either metal or plastic, they are designed to be flush-mounted in walls or ceilings, providing easy access to plumbing, electrical, and HVAC systems. B2B buyers should consider the installation requirements and the potential need for additional framing, as these panels may not provide insulation or soundproofing. They are ideal for general maintenance but may not be suitable for specialized applications.

Fire-Rated Access Panel

Fire-rated access panels are constructed using materials that can withstand high temperatures, making them essential in areas where fire safety is a concern, such as commercial buildings and industrial facilities. These panels are designed to meet specific safety regulations, ensuring that they contribute to the overall integrity of fire-rated walls and ceilings. Buyers should weigh the higher cost against the benefits of compliance and safety. They are an excellent choice for businesses prioritizing safety in their operations.

Insulated Access Panel

Insulated access panels incorporate thermal insulation, making them ideal for environments where temperature control is vital, such as HVAC systems or insulated plumbing areas. These panels help reduce energy costs by preventing heat loss and can also provide soundproofing benefits. When purchasing insulated panels, buyers should consider the installation complexity and the higher price point, which may be justified by long-term energy savings and improved comfort in temperature-sensitive environments.

Access Door with Lock

Access doors equipped with locks offer enhanced security for areas housing sensitive equipment or materials. These doors are particularly useful in environments where unauthorized access could pose risks, such as data centers or utility rooms. Buyers should evaluate the balance between cost and security needs, as these doors may be more expensive and can slow down access for maintenance personnel. Nonetheless, they are essential for businesses that prioritize security in their facilities.

Custom Access Panel

Custom access panels are designed to meet specific project requirements, allowing for tailored solutions in unique environments. These panels can be made in various sizes and with specific features to fit particular applications, making them suitable for specialized installations. While they offer the advantage of maximizing space efficiency, buyers should be prepared for longer lead times and potentially higher costs. Custom panels are best for businesses with unique needs that standard options cannot satisfy.

Strategic Material Selection Guide for access panel lowes

When selecting materials for access panels, it is crucial for international B2B buyers to understand the properties, advantages, and limitations of the most commonly used materials. This knowledge will help ensure that the chosen material meets the specific requirements of the application while also complying with regional standards and preferences.

1. Steel (Galvanized and Stainless)

Key Properties:
Steel, particularly galvanized and stainless variants, offers high strength and durability. Galvanized steel is coated with zinc to prevent corrosion, while stainless steel contains chromium, enhancing its corrosion resistance. Both types can withstand high temperatures and pressures, making them suitable for various environments.

Pros & Cons:
Galvanized steel is cost-effective and widely available, making it a popular choice for general use. However, it may not perform well in highly corrosive environments. Stainless steel, while more expensive, offers superior corrosion resistance and is ideal for applications involving moisture or chemicals. The manufacturing complexity is higher for stainless steel, which may affect lead times.

Impact on Application:
Steel access panels are suitable for environments where structural integrity is paramount. However, buyers must consider the specific media compatibility, especially in corrosive settings.

Considerations for International Buyers:
Compliance with standards such as ASTM (for the U.S.) or EN (for Europe) is essential. Buyers in regions like South Africa and Poland should ensure that the selected steel grade meets local regulations.

2. Aluminum

Key Properties:
Aluminum is lightweight and has excellent corrosion resistance due to its natural oxide layer. It can handle moderate temperatures and pressures, making it suitable for various applications.

Pros & Cons:
The primary advantage of aluminum is its lightweight nature, which reduces installation costs and labor. However, it may not be as strong as steel, which could limit its use in heavy-duty applications. The manufacturing process is generally simpler, but the cost can be higher compared to galvanized steel.

Impact on Application:
Aluminum access panels are well-suited for environments where weight savings are critical, such as in aerospace or certain construction applications. It is important to assess the compatibility with the specific media being accessed.

Considerations for International Buyers:
Buyers should look for compliance with international standards such as ASTM or ISO. In regions like the Middle East, where high temperatures are common, ensuring the aluminum grade is appropriate for thermal expansion is crucial.

3. Plastic (PVC and ABS)

Key Properties:
Plastic materials like PVC (Polyvinyl Chloride) and ABS (Acrylonitrile Butadiene Styrene) are lightweight and resistant to moisture and chemicals. They can handle lower pressures and temperatures compared to metals.

Pros & Cons:
Plastic access panels are cost-effective and easy to install, making them suitable for non-structural applications. However, they are less durable than metal options and may not withstand high temperatures or heavy loads. Manufacturing complexity is low, allowing for rapid production.

Impact on Application:
Plastic panels are ideal for environments where corrosion is a concern, such as in chemical processing or wet areas. However, they may not be suitable for high-pressure applications.

Considerations for International Buyers:
Buyers should ensure that the plastics used comply with local regulations, especially regarding fire safety and chemical resistance. Standards such as ASTM D1784 for PVC should be checked.

4. Fiberglass Reinforced Plastic (FRP)

Key Properties:
FRP combines the lightweight nature of plastics with enhanced strength and durability. It offers excellent corrosion resistance and can withstand a range of temperatures.

Pros & Cons:
FRP is highly resistant to chemicals and moisture, making it suitable for harsh environments. However, it can be more expensive than traditional plastics and may require specialized installation techniques. The manufacturing process can be complex, impacting lead times.

Impact on Application:
FRP access panels are ideal for environments with high humidity or exposure to chemicals, such as wastewater treatment facilities. Their strength makes them suitable for applications where structural integrity is essential.

Considerations for International Buyers:
Compliance with relevant standards like ASTM D638 for tensile strength is important. Buyers in regions with strict environmental regulations should ensure that the FRP materials meet local compliance standards.

Manufacturing Processes

1. Material Preparation

The first stage in the manufacturing of access panels involves sourcing and preparing raw materials. Common materials include galvanized steel, aluminum, and plastic, each chosen for their durability and suitability for specific applications.

  • Material Selection: It’s essential for manufacturers to select materials that meet specific performance criteria, such as corrosion resistance and load-bearing capacity.
  • Cutting and Shaping: Raw materials are cut to size using precision cutting tools. Techniques such as laser cutting or CNC machining are often employed to ensure accuracy and reduce waste.

2. Forming

Once materials are prepared, the next step is forming them into the desired shapes.

  • Bending and Stamping: This process often involves bending metal sheets into the required configurations or stamping them into specific shapes. Techniques such as deep drawing may also be used, especially for complex shapes that require high precision.
  • Molding (for plastic panels): For plastic access panels, injection molding is a common method, allowing for intricate designs and uniform thickness.

3. Assembly

After individual components are formed, they are assembled to create the final product.

  • Joining Techniques: Various joining methods are utilized, including welding, riveting, and adhesive bonding. Each technique is selected based on the material type and the structural requirements of the access panel.
  • Component Integration: This stage may also involve integrating additional features such as insulation, gaskets, or locks, depending on the intended application of the access panel.

4. Finishing

The finishing process enhances the aesthetic appeal and functional performance of the access panels.

  • Surface Treatment: Common treatments include powder coating, painting, or galvanizing to improve corrosion resistance and durability.
  • Quality Checks: At this stage, initial quality checks are performed to ensure that the product meets specified tolerances and quality standards.

Quality Assurance

Quality assurance is a critical aspect of the manufacturing process, ensuring that access panels meet both regulatory and customer standards.

International Standards

B2B buyers should be aware of various international standards that govern manufacturing quality, such as:

  • ISO 9001: This standard focuses on quality management systems and is applicable across various industries, ensuring that manufacturers consistently provide products that meet customer and regulatory requirements.
  • CE Marking: For European markets, products must comply with certain health, safety, and environmental protection standards to be sold in the EU.

Industry-Specific Standards

Access panels may also need to adhere to industry-specific standards, such as:

  • API Standards: For panels used in industrial applications, adherence to API standards may be required, ensuring safety and performance in oil and gas environments.
  • UL Certification: For electrical panels, Underwriters Laboratories (UL) certification is often necessary to ensure safety and reliability.

Quality Control Checkpoints

Effective quality control involves multiple checkpoints throughout the manufacturing process:

  • Incoming Quality Control (IQC): This involves inspecting raw materials upon arrival to ensure they meet specified standards.
  • In-Process Quality Control (IPQC): Continuous monitoring during manufacturing ensures that any defects are identified and addressed immediately.
  • Final Quality Control (FQC): A comprehensive inspection is conducted on the finished product to verify compliance with specifications before shipping.

Common Testing Methods

Various testing methods are employed to validate the quality and performance of access panels:

  • Mechanical Testing: This includes tensile strength, impact resistance, and load testing to ensure structural integrity.
  • Environmental Testing: Panels may undergo tests simulating extreme weather conditions to evaluate their durability and resistance to corrosion.
  • Dimensional Inspection: Automated measuring systems or manual calipers are used to ensure that the dimensions of the access panels meet design specifications.

Verifying Supplier Quality Control

For B2B buyers, particularly those sourcing from international markets, verifying a supplier’s quality control processes is essential:

  • Audits: Conducting on-site audits helps buyers assess the manufacturer’s compliance with quality standards and operational practices.
  • Quality Reports: Requesting detailed quality assurance reports can provide insights into the supplier’s testing methodologies and historical performance.
  • Third-Party Inspections: Engaging third-party inspection services can help ensure impartial verification of product quality before shipment.

Essential Technical Properties and Trade Terminology for access panel lowes

Key Technical Properties of Access Panels

When sourcing access panels from Lowe’s, understanding specific technical properties is crucial for making informed purchasing decisions. Here are several critical specifications to consider:

  1. Material Grade
    Access panels are typically made from materials such as metal, plastic, or gypsum board. The material grade affects durability, weight, and resistance to environmental factors. For example, galvanized steel panels offer superior strength and corrosion resistance, making them ideal for high-humidity environments. Choosing the right material ensures longevity and performance, which are essential for reducing replacement costs.

  2. Dimensions and Tolerances
    Accurate dimensions (length, width, height) and tolerances (acceptable deviations from specified measurements) are vital for ensuring a proper fit within the wall or ceiling space. Tolerances are particularly important in construction and renovation projects where precise measurements can prevent complications during installation. Poorly fitting panels may lead to increased labor costs and delays.

  3. Load-Bearing Capacity
    This specification indicates how much weight the access panel can support without compromising its integrity. It’s critical for applications in commercial settings, such as HVAC systems or plumbing access, where heavy equipment may be present. Understanding load requirements helps in selecting a panel that can withstand operational stresses, ensuring safety and functionality.

  4. Fire Rating
    Fire-rated access panels are essential in commercial and industrial settings where building codes require specific fire resistance levels. This rating indicates how long the panel can withstand exposure to fire while maintaining its structural integrity. Selecting fire-rated panels can significantly enhance safety and compliance with local regulations.

  5. Finish and Aesthetic Options
    The finish of an access panel—be it painted, textured, or plain—can impact its integration into the surrounding environment. Aesthetic considerations may be crucial for buyers focused on maintaining a specific interior design. Choosing the right finish can enhance the overall appearance of a space while still providing necessary functionality.

  6. Sealing Mechanisms
    Access panels may feature gaskets or seals to provide airtight or watertight properties. This is particularly important in environments where moisture or contaminants could enter through the panel. Understanding sealing mechanisms helps buyers ensure that the panel meets specific environmental requirements, thus preserving the integrity of the systems behind it.

Frequently Asked Questions (FAQs) for B2B Buyers of access panel lowes

  1. What should I consider when vetting suppliers for access panels?
    When vetting suppliers for access panels, prioritize their industry experience and reliability. Investigate their production capabilities, quality assurance processes, and compliance with international standards. Check for relevant certifications, such as ISO 9001, which demonstrate a commitment to quality management. Engage in direct communication to clarify their understanding of your specific needs. Additionally, seek references from other clients to assess their performance history and reliability in meeting deadlines and quality standards.

  2. Can I customize access panels to meet specific project requirements?
    Yes, many suppliers offer customization options for access panels, allowing you to specify dimensions, materials, and finishes that align with your project needs. When discussing customization, provide detailed specifications to ensure that the supplier can meet your requirements. It’s also beneficial to inquire about their design capabilities and whether they can provide prototypes or samples before full production. Early engagement in the design process can help mitigate any potential issues later in the project.

  3. What are the typical minimum order quantities (MOQs) and lead times for access panels?
    Minimum order quantities (MOQs) for access panels can vary significantly by supplier and product type. Generally, MOQs can range from a few dozen to several hundred units. Lead times may also fluctuate based on customization, production capacity, and shipping logistics, typically ranging from 4 to 12 weeks. It’s essential to confirm these details upfront to ensure they align with your project timeline. For large orders, negotiating favorable terms may be possible, so do not hesitate to discuss your specific needs with the supplier.

  4. What payment terms should I expect when sourcing access panels?
    Payment terms for access panels can differ widely among suppliers. Common arrangements include a deposit upfront (often 30-50%) with the balance due upon delivery or before shipment. Some suppliers may offer credit terms for established buyers. It’s crucial to negotiate terms that are mutually beneficial and to clarify any penalties for late payments. Additionally, consider using secure payment methods, such as letters of credit or escrow services, to protect your investment, especially in international transactions.
